Transaction 30c58dbf49a8570839edaffd19da4df64b9df09d454a9991081237e7155b19ab
1 Input
2 Outputs
- 30c58dbf49a8570839edaffd19da4df64b9df09d454a9991081237e7155b19ab:0
- 30c58dbf49a8570839edaffd19da4df64b9df09d454a9991081237e7155b19ab:1
value 39627
address 1LhADcf7gx8WXfH5x6cQBbHLQ8gWgaAV7R
value 370000
address 19NQBx374zQrKrWXW6vjJ7ewCSyirTvy22